{"library":"vue2-to-3","type":"library","category":null,"description":"A CLI tool that automatically migrates Vue 2 Options API JavaScript files to Vue 3 Composition API style. Current stable version is 0.4.5 (beta). Release cadence is irregular; maintained by a single developer. Key differentiator: it splits Vue 2 component options (data, methods, computed) into separate Composition API files, factoring out logical concerns into individual composition functions. Currently supports only .js files, planned support for .ts and .vue SFC. Requires Vue 2.x as a peer dependency for initial project, but the output is Vue 3 compatible.","language":"javascript","status":"active","version":"0.4.5","tags":["javascript","vue","vue2","vue3","migration","composition","typescript"],"last_verified":"Sun Jun 07","install":[{"cmd":"npm install vue2-to-3","imports":["npx vue2-to-3 ./src/component.js","migrate ./src/Component.js","import { reactive } from 'vue'"]},{"cmd":"yarn add vue2-to-3","imports":[]},{"cmd":"pnpm add vue2-to-3","imports":[]}],"homepage":"https://github.com/IldarDavletyarov/vue2-to-3#readme","github":"https://github.com/IldarDavletyarov/vue2-to-3","docs":null,"changelog":null,"pypi":null,"npm":"vue2-to-3","openapi_spec":null,"status_page":null,"smithery":null,"compatibility":null}